In vitro exploration of phytoextracts against stem rot of white onion (Allium cepa L.) caused by Sclerotium rolfsii Sacc.

The fungus, Sclerotium rolfsii Sacc. associated with naturally infected white onion plant was isolated and its pathogenicity was proved. Six phytoextracts viz., Azadirachta indica, Allium sativum, Sapindus mukorossi, Ocimum tenuiflorum, Lantana camara and Calotropis gigantea were evaluated against Sclerotium rolfsii by following poisoned food technique at 10 and 20 percent concentration in vitro. Among phytoextracts tested Sapindus mukorossi was most effective both at lower (10%) and higher (20%) concentration with 47.22% and 52.22% inhibition over control, respectively followed by Azadirachta indica (23.14% & 30%) and Allium sativum (15% & 38.33%).
